The trek is easy and provides the spectac ular views of the Langtang (7245m), Ganesh Himal (7405m), Dorje Lhakpa (6990m) and other small mountains of Langtang Himalayan range. The warm and friendly people of helambu are mostly Buddhists. It is an ideal trip for those who have a short time and like to combine both cultural scene. You will enjoy visiting the culturally rich Tamang villages, Buddhist Gompas and the fantastic landscape with rice fields.
This trek is ideal for people with less time who do not wish to travel too far from the Kathmandu Valley . Helambu is a lush region to the North of Kathmandu inhabited by Sherpas and Tamang people although the Sherpas of this region differ in their practices from their cousins in the Everest region.The trek passes through some beautiful forests and very interesting villages on route. | Suggested itinerary :10 Nights / 11 Days |
|
Day 01: Arrival in Kathmandu airport and transfer to hotel. ( A. ) |
Day 02: Guided sight seeing in Kathmandu valley. ( B, A) |
Day 03: Departure to Sundarijal by Taxi then trek to Pati Bhanjyang (1768 m) ( B, L, D, A) |
Day 04: Trek from Chisapani to Kutumsang ( B, L, D, A) |
Day 05: Trek from Kutumsang to Tharepati 3275m ( B, L, D, A) |
Day 06: Trekking from Tharepati to Melamchigaon (2560 m) ( B, L, D, A) |
Day 07: Trek from Melamchigaon (2560 m) to Tarkeghyang (2560 m) ( B, L, D, A) |
Day 08: Trek from Tarkeghyang (2560 m) to Sarmanthnag (2621 m) ( B, L, D, A) |
Day 09: Sarmanthnag (2621 m) to Kakani (2000 m) ( B, L, D, A) |
Day 10: Kakani (2000 m) Melamchi Pull Bazar (848 m). ( B, L, D, A) |
Day 11: Drive back to Kathmandu and transfer to your hotel.( B, L, A) |

Newly promoted trekking area in lantang Regiopn : |
| |
This is newly promoted trekking areas of Nepal lies on the north in the lantang region . This trek is not very hard trek but very non-touristy, cultural and peaceful. The lodges are not available during the route. up to Goshain kunda. Thus, the tour must be arranged a fully organized by camping.
